Features

  • Put a muzzle on your loudmouth brakes with EBC's mouse-quiet Ultimax Brake Pads
  • EBC custom-makes your Ultimax Brake Pads to directly replace your stock gear
  • Beveled edges significantly reduce brake whine, prevent edge lifting, and actually prolong the life of your EBC Ultimax Brake Pads
  • Pre-fitted anti-noise shims further muffle your EBC Ultimax Brake Pads
  • Custom blend of synthetic aramid fibers and metallic filament for an aggressive bite, no vibration, and extended lifespan
  • EBC's own Break-In surface coating provides lightning-fast bedding for maximum braking power right out of the box
  • All EBC Ultimax Brake Pads boast a center-line slot to ward off heat expansion cracks
  • The pads and the pad plates are powder coated for a lifetime of rust-free service
  • EBC covers your Ultimax Brake Pads with a 6-month/5,000 mile warranty

Description

Let's face it: most brake pads squeal like a stuck pig. And, there's nothing more annoying (or embarrassing) than hearing that ear-piercing shriek, especially in stop-and-go traffic. For whisper-quiet brakes that still deliver an aggressive grip, get your hands on a set of EBC Ultimax Brake Pads. These direct replacement pads fit like stock, but they're miles ahead of any factory brakes.

Keen engineering is what makes your EBC Ultimax Brake Pads so silent. Their beveled edges and factory-fitted shims turn down the volume on you brake pedal. Plus, the chamfered rim fights off edge lifting to block against corrosion and pad-separation.

Even better, your EBC Ultimax Brake Pads' special blend of synthetic and metallic fibers gives you smooth braking, a firm bite, and extended life. There's even a unique Break-In surface coating for near instant bedding, and the center-line slot stops heat cracks. EBC also covers your Ultimax Brake Pads with a 6-month/5,000 mile warranty.
